Rothbury-area historical tornado activity is below Michigan state average. It is 30% smaller than the overall U.S. average.

On 4/11/1965, a category 4 (max. wind speeds 207-260 mph) tornado 39.9 miles away from the Rothbury village center killed 5 people and injured 142 people and caused between $500,000 and $5,000,000 in damages.

On 4/3/1956, a category 5 (max. wind speeds 261-318 mph) tornado 54.9 miles away from the village center killed 18 people and injured 340 people and caused between $50,000 and $500,000 in damages.
